Ellen S. Foley, 57 Marlborough - Ellen S. (Northrop) Foley, 57, died Monday, Aug. 27, 2007 at St. Vincent Hospital in Worcester after an illness. She was the wife of the late John Foley, who died in 1986. She leaves her daughter, Tamie Darby; her son, Michael Foley; her siblings, Mary Quinlan, Susan McEnaney, Marian Constantine, Margaret Mullen, John Constantine, Edward Constantine, Thomas Constantine and Kevin Constantine; her companion of many years, Donald O'Leary Jr.; and her grandchildren, Melinda Darby and Timothy Darby. Born in Boston, the daughter of Robert and Mary (Carroll) Northrop, she lived most of her life in Marlborough and graduated from Marlborough High School. Mrs. Foley worked for over 10 years in the Town of Framingham's Clerk's office. She later worked as a bartender at the former Highland House in Marlborough and at the Marlborough V.F.W. Post 638. She was a member of the Ladies Auxiliary at V.F.W. Post 638, the Ladies Auxiliary of AMVETS Post 1980 in Marlborough, and the Ladies Auxiliary of the Moose of Marlborough. Graveside services were held Aug. 30 at St. Patrick's Cemetery in Natick. The John P. Rowe Funeral Home of Marlborough directed arrangements. |
